Sox Bloggers SPOT supports Global Handwashing Day, donates hygiene kits to Pag-asa Integrated School

In support of the celebration of the Global Handwashing Day, the SOCCSKSARGEN Bloggers a.k.a. Sox Bloggers conducted an event called Fun Day with the Kids of Pag-asa Integrated School, today, October 13, 2022.



Sox Bloggers is a community of bloggers, vloggers, and social media influencers who are creating content to show the “real image” of SOCCSKSARGEN to the world and help promote local businesses, events, places, and activities.

For their project SPOT (Service. Partnership. Outreach. Thanksgiving.) the Sox Bloggers partnered with International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(IPI), which donated over 100 hygiene kits, containing Bioderm soap bars and Casino Rubbing alcohol, for the learners of Pag-asa IS.

Bloggers Jake Claudius Clave and Michael Carbon facilitated fun games with the kids, while Chiclet Rillo taught the kids proper handwashing and the importance of good hygiene practices.

“Aside from proper hygiene, we also think that kids should develop the habit of hydration at a young age. That is why we are giving them tumblers, which they could use to bring their own drinking water to school,” Rillo said.









Ricky Bustos delivered a talk on leadership and media literacy to the officers of the Supreme Pupil Government, Supreme Student Government, and IP organization.

The participating learners also received school supplies and Jollibee food packs.

“Thank you for choosing our school as your beneficiary,” School Principal Marissa P. Jamili expressed her gratitude for the said activity.




“This is our way of giving back and paying it forward. We distributed school supplies because we want the kids to give importance to their education and that even if they are in a place that is quite far from the city, they can have great opportunities in life if they will study hard,” Michael Carbon said.

“We are thanking IPI and Jollibee, as well as the local government of Sarangani headed by Gov. Ruel D. Pacquiao and Vice-Gov. Elmer T. De Peralta, for supporting the event,” Avel Mananansala, Sox Bloggers lead convenor added.

Marcos appoints key officials to DepEd leadership

President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. has appointed several key figures, including Ronald Mendoza, a former dean of the Ateneo School of Government, and Georgina Yang, former spokesperson for Vice President Leni Robredo, to leadership roles at the Department of Education (DepEd), MalacaƱang announced on Thursday, October 3. Mendoza has been named Undersecretary for Policy and Planning at DepEd. With over 25 years of experience in development policy and public administration, he previously served as Associate Professor of Economics at the Asian Institute of Management and as a senior economist at the United Nations in New York. Mendoza was also appointed to the United Nations Economic and Social Council’s Committee of Experts on Public Administration (CEPA) from 2021 to 2025. Georgina Yang, former executive director of the Galing Pook Foundation and spokesperson for Vice President Robredo, has been appointed Assistant Secretary under the DepEd Office of the Secretary. Expanded Career Progression System: A New Era for Public School Teachers in the Philippines

Public school teachers across the Philippines now have a clearer and more structured path for career advancement, thanks to the recently completed Implementing Rules and Regulations (IRR) for Executive Order No. 174, Series of 2022 . This order establishes the Expanded Career Progression System for Public School Teachers . The ceremonial signing of the IRR, led by DepEd Secretary Sonny Angara, took place at the DepEd Central Office on 26 July 2024, marking a significant milestone in the professional growth of teachers. This new system is set to reshape the teaching profession, providing a more dynamic and flexible career trajectory. The signing event was attended by key education stakeholders, including Dr. Jennie Jocson, who played a vital role in crafting the new system through RITQ’s technical assistance.
